Output 43526cc36c10e04d885940971b285cb06f0cad62f04fc98df6164fe30036ac5a:3

value
62384
script pubkey
OP_0 OP_PUSHBYTES_20 ab1212a291fa9251fd57e637ae016490341c09fa
address
tb1q4vfp9g53l2f9rl2hucm6uqtyjq6pcz06x5cqqx
transaction
43526cc36c10e04d885940971b285cb06f0cad62f04fc98df6164fe30036ac5a